Onboarding · an intensive partnership
For the first 2–4 weeks, Jonathan and Adina work closely with your team. We learn your language, systems, decisions and bottlenecks — then turn them into a first library of useful Miiwa agents.
Jonathan & Adina · directly involved
Interviews, working sessions and access to the material that shows how work is actually done.
We identify recurring tasks, decision points, data sources and approvals where agents can create real value.
We design, connect and test the first portfolio with your knowledge, brand, rules and systems built in.
The agents are published as finished tools. We train your builders and stay close through the first real runs.

Proof of value, built in
On My Runs, users leave feedback and record how long a task normally takes. The platform computes time saved, per run and in aggregate. And every output can be kept in a vault with managed access.
